TRIMED, INC. v. SHERWOOD MEDICAL CO.

No. 91-2210.

977 F.2d 885 (1992)

TRIMED, INCORPORATED, a Maryland Corporation, Plaintiff-Appellee, v. SHERWOOD MEDICAL COMPANY, a Delaware Corporation, Defendant-Appellant.

United States Court of Appeals, Fourth Circuit.

Decided October 15, 1992.

As Amended November 3, 1992.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

J. Hardin Marion, Tydings & Rosenberg, Baltimore, Md., argued (Thomas M. Wilson, III, on brief), for defendant-appellant.

John Earl Griffith, Jr., Piper & Marbury, Baltimore, Md., argued (Charles P. Scheeler, William W. Toole, Ann Burke Lloyd, William Single, IV, on brief), for plaintiff-appellee.

Before RUSSELL and LUTTIG, Circuit Judges, and KELLAM, Senior United States District Judge for the Eastern District of Virginia, sitting by designation.


OPINION

DONALD RUSSELL, Circuit Judge:

Appellant Sherwood Medical Co. appeals a jury verdict and awards for Trimed, Inc. in an action for tortious business practices and breach of contract. Sherwood challenges the court's jury instructions under Maryland law regarding tortious interference with contracts, unfair competition, and punitive damages.
